Hakkımda:
Where do you start,? I don't know many of the lyrics from the Sound of music,but if I do remember from singing it many years ago at school it did mention something like "lets start at the very beginning".
I was born as an only child,(thus the spoilt bit maybe) to Jack & Grace Wright,both sadly departed this mortal coil,in Wymington a small North Bedfordshire village in 1950.
I didnt' really go much on the 1950's and I think I was just waiting for the next & best decade to explode into my life.!
The music,the fashion,the liberation and the overall feeling of well being just washed over everybody & everything.
My involvement in the music was probably unleashed in about 1963,when I have to trade my love of the Hornby train set for a drum kit.(no contest in many ways),although I would love the train set again now.
My mates and myself formed the obligatory group and played at the village youth club,and once you have experienced that thrill of doing any public performance you are hooked on the adrenalin rush.
My love of the music went off at the now obvious tangent of listening to Radio Luxembourg,(I know you have read all about that from anyone else who has been like me & Nobby no mates sort of a bloke).
But out of all this came a very serious and deep obsession when the offshore radio explosion came on the airwaves in 1964 and the breath of fresh air from the likes of Radio Caroline.
In the December of that same year the slickest station joined Caroline off Frinton-on-sea in Essex & she was Radio London.
Even after we had the thrill of Radio London & Radio Caroline which went out on medium wave,it was still my want to take the transistor radio to bed with me & go up and down the dial just longing to pick up a new station.I seem to recall plenty of propaganda stuff coming out of some countries that were transmitting utter political garbage.But in between all of that I would get a buzz from wondering what is what like where the announcer was sitting,be it he or she, and I think that is what you still get from the wireless.You see sometimes too much on television & you don't have to get out that mental paintbrush and canvas.So radio will always score in that department.
I never got out of that yearning for the better things in life radio wise,and wanted to spin my own discs(as they were then)so I combined my un-dying love of the 60's music, my addiction to drumming and came up with the show that I have done for many years the "60's Sunday.(you may yell from the cheap seats,grow up and come into the 21st century),but I am that deaf now that I can't hear you anyway.!!!!
